Output 645fc5d18f58dceabea0357e7dda9529c4d7a75e744006eb7f1093cf061af864:64

value
364081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df20814c6a9942f74de0636693255528bf3d366f OP_EQUAL
address
3N2oYpAPdJmc48dBewE42gxjStFJMve8Vv
transaction
645fc5d18f58dceabea0357e7dda9529c4d7a75e744006eb7f1093cf061af864
spent
true